What Makes Dog Food “Best”? (Scientifically Proven)
According to the Association of American Feed Control Officials (AAFCO), a good dog food must be complete and balanced, meaning it includes:
- High-quality protein
- Essential fatty acids
- Vitamins & minerals
- Digestible carbohydrates
- Correct calcium-phosphorus ratio
The World Small Animal Veterinary Association (WSAVA) also recommends choosing food from brands that:
- Employ veterinary nutritionists
- Conduct feeding trials
- Follow strict safety standards
(Source: AAFCO Nutrient Profiles 2023; WSAVA Global Nutrition Guidelines)
Breed-Based Diet Guide (Indian Popular Breeds)
1. Small Breeds (Shih Tzu, Pug, Lhasa Apso, Pomeranian)
Best Food Type:
✔ High-protein small kibble
✔ Omega-3 for skin (Mumbai humidity causes skin issues)
✔ Easily digestible ingredients
Budget Option:
- Quality dry food + boiled chicken topper
Premium Option:
- Breed-specific small dog food with probiotics
2. Medium Breeds (Beagle, Indie/Desi Dog, Cocker Spaniel)
Best Food Type:
✔ Balanced protein (22–26%)
✔ Moderate fat
✔ Fiber for digestion
Indie dogs especially adapt well to:
- Rice + chicken + commercial kibble mix
Budget families in Kalyan/Dombivli often prefer this combo — and it works well if balanced properly.
3. Large Breeds (Labrador, Golden Retriever, German Shepherd)
Most Popular in Thane & Mumbai
Best Food Type:
✔ Controlled calcium
✔ Joint support (Glucosamine)
✔ Weight management
Large breeds are prone to:
- Obesity
- Hip dysplasia
- Joint pain
The American Kennel Club recommends large-breed-specific formulas to prevent growth disorders.
Dry vs Wet vs Homemade (Which Is Better in India?)
| Type | Best For | Cost | Recommendation |
|---|---|---|---|
| Dry Food | Daily feeding | Budget-friendly | Most practical |
| Wet Food | Picky eaters | Expensive | Occasional |
| Homemade | Sensitive dogs | Time-consuming | Only if balanced |
⚠️ According to the American Veterinary Medical Association, many homemade diets lack essential nutrients unless properly formulated.
So for most Mumbai
pet parents:
👉 High-quality dry food + fresh protein topper = best balance

🚫 What NOT to Feed Your Dog
The ASPCA warns against:
❌ Chocolate
❌ Grapes
❌ Onions
❌ Excess salt
❌ Fried food
These are toxic and common mistakes in Indian households.
